gpt4 book ai didi

android - 如何在android studio中制作aar

转载 作者:行者123 更新时间:2023-12-03 06:19:01 34 4
gpt4 key购买 nike

我有以下 build.gradle 文件:

    apply plugin: 'android-library'
apply plugin: 'maven'


android {
compileSdkVersion 19
buildToolsVersion '19.1'
sourceSets {
main {
manifest.srcFile 'AndroidManifest.xml'
java.srcDirs = ['src']
}
}
defaultConfig {
minSdkVersion 15
targetSdkVersion 19
versionCode 1
versionName "1.0"
}

lintOptions {
abortOnError false
}
}

dependencies {
compile project(':olympus-commons')
compile project(':stream-client')
compile project(':door-proxy')

compile 'com.google.guava:guava:17.0'

compile 'to.talk.aragorn:logging:0.1-SNAPSHOT@aar'
compile 'to.talk.aragorn:event-utils:0.1-SNAPSHOT@aar'
compile 'to.talk.aragorn:commons:0.30-SNAPSHOT@aar'

}

def coreAarFile = file('build/conman-client.aar')
artifacts {
archives coreAarFile
}

uploadArchives {
repositories {
mavenDeployer {
repository(url: "http://ci.aws.talk.to:8081/nexus/content/repositories/snapshots",
authentication: [
userName: 'deployer',
password: 'qwedsa'
])
pom.groupId = 'to.talk.legolas'
pom.artifactId = 'conman-client'
pom.version = '1.01-SNAPSHOT'
}
}
}

当我构建模块时,它构建成功。但我没有看到 骗子客户端.aar 生成。这可能是什么原因?

我在一篇文章中读到添加 应用插件:'android-library' 到 build.gradle 文件将在构建模块时生成 .aar 文件。

但这并没有发生。这可能是什么原因?

谢谢

最佳答案

这是插件:

apply plugin: 'com.android.library'



如果您添加一个 android 库模块,它将自动设置,并且当您构建它时,它将在 build/outputs/arr 中创建一个 arr 文件

关于android - 如何在android studio中制作aar,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27657145/

34 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com